Programming Java Concurrency
Stuart Halloway
|
Spring Intro
Justin Gehtland
|
Introduction to Hibernate
Justin Gehtland
|
Advanced Hibernate
Justin Gehtland
|
Beginning Drools - Rule Engines in Java
Brian Sam-Bodden
|
Advanced Object-Relational Mapping with Hibernate
Brian Sam-Bodden
|
Understanding and Implementing Pluggable Application Architectures
David Bock
|
Unit Testing Java with Jython and JRuby
Stuart Halloway
|
Introduction to Java Reflection
Stuart Halloway
|
Felix: A bag of Tricks for Java Server Faces
David Geary
|
Shale: Turbo-charge your JSF Apps
David Geary
|
Writing Secure Web Services (with Java and Axis)
Justin Gehtland
|
Spring Security with ACEGI
Justin Gehtland
|
Killer Web UIs
David Geary
|
Creating Polished Swing Applications
Scott Delap
|
5 Minutes Forms with JGoodies Binding and Validation
Scott Delap
|
SWT Fundamentals
Scott Delap
|
The Fallacies of Enterprise Systems
Ted Neward
|
Design Patterns Revisited: Taking advantage of dynamic, reflective languages
Stuart Halloway
|
Design Patterns Revisited: Taking advantage of dynamic, reflective languages
Stuart Halloway
|
Java Platform Security and JAAS
Stuart Halloway
|
Effective Enterprise Java: Security
Ted Neward
|
Effective Enterprise Architecture
Ted Neward
|
Applied Object-Oriented Metrics
Brian Sletten
|
Applied AOP
Brian Sletten
|
Applied Design Patterns
Brian Sletten
|
Software Metrics and the Great Pyramid of Giza
David Bock
|
XML made easy with XOM
Brian Sam-Bodden
|
Complex Builds with Ant
Brian Sam-Bodden
|